随着加密货币的普及,越来越多的人开始关注如何安全地存储自己的数字资产。硬件钱包因其安全性而备受推崇,但市面上的硬件钱包价格不菲,许多用户开始探索自制加密硬件钱包的可能性。本文将详细讲解自制加密硬件钱包的使用方法,并为读者提供相关的安全建议与最佳实践。
加密硬件钱包是一种存储加密货币的设备,能够安全地保存用户的私钥,而不与上网分开的环境进行交互。这种物理设备的优势在于它能够防止黑客攻击、木马病毒等网络安全威胁。硬件钱包通常使用了安全芯片和加密算法,确保交易过程的安全。
硬件钱包的运作原理相对简单:用户将自己的私钥存储在硬件钱包中,通过网络交易时,仅需在设备上进行身份验证,而不直接将私钥暴露给网络。这样即使是在不安全的网络环境中,用户的资产也能得到保护。
自制加密硬件钱包有几个显著的优势。首先,用户可以完全控制自己的私钥,避免信任第三方服务带来的风险。其次,自制硬件钱包相比市面上现成的产品,成本通常更低。此外,自制过程还可以大幅度增强用户对加密技术的理解,有助于提升个人的安全意识。
然而,自制硬件钱包也有其挑战。对技术没有基础的用户在制作过程中可能会遇到困难,并且需要额外关注安全问题,确保自己的自制设备不会成为攻击者的目标。
制作加密硬件钱包的基本材料包括微控制器、显示屏、筐体、按键、连接线等。一般来说,最常用的微控制器是一种如Arduino或Raspberry Pi等开源硬件。此外,用户还需要准备一些编程工具,如IDE和相应的库文件,以确保后期的程序编写与调试顺利。
对于外壳的设计,用户可以使用3D打印或现成的外壳进行保护。在确保安全的同时,外壳的设计也要便于用户操作与日常携带。
自制加密硬件钱包的步骤通常包括以下几步:
一旦自制硬件钱包完成,使用过程中需要注意一些操作流程。首先,用户需要确保设备已经成功安装了相应的固件,并且连接配置正常。然后可以按照以下步骤操作:
为了确保自制加密硬件钱包的安全,用户需要注意以下几点:
自制硬件钱包的安全性很多时候取决于用户的技术水平以及遵循的安全实践。网络攻击目标主要集中在那些展现出安全漏洞的系统上,因而用户在制作和使用自制硬件钱包时,切勿忽视安全性和防护措施。这包括保持设备离线、定期更新、确保护管私钥等都是提升安全性的有效方法。
然而如果用户对硬件或软件没有相应的了解,自制硬件钱包的安全性会受到一定的影响。因此,推荐只有在具备足够技术知识和安全意识的用户尝试自制硬件钱包。同时,也可参考已有的优秀案例,借鉴其成功的设计思路与方法。
自制硬件钱包的兼容性主要与微控制器所支持的程序和应用密切相关。用户可以根据开发环境与编程方式,选择包括比特币、以太坊、莱特币等主要加密货币。此外,许多开源库已经为这些热门加密货币提供了支持,使得自制钱包能够支持多种数字资产。
如果用户希望实现更多加密货币的支持,可通过相应的API接口与SDK进行适配,添加对其他数字资产的支持,但相应的开发和测试成本也会相应提高。
为了提升自制硬件钱包的安全性,仅靠制作本身是不够的,用户还需考虑多重安全策略来守护自己的数字资产。以下是几个建议:
市面上的硬件钱包通常由专业团队开发,并具备全面的认证证书和安全评估。它们的设计目标主要是用户友好性和安全性,同时经过严格的测试,确保其具有高度稳定性与兼容性。此外,商业产品通常提供成熟的用户支持与更新维护,用户可以享受到稳定的服务保障。
相反,自制硬件钱包在实现过程的掌控力上更强,但缺乏经过严格测试的安全标准,且对初学者可能存在一定技术门槛。用户需要对自己所制作的产品进行全面的验证与维护,确保能够应对潜在风险。
私钥是硬件钱包中最敏感的内容,备份手段尤其重要。用户可以选择以下几种备份方式:
随着加密货币的普及,自制加密硬件钱包的需求也在不断增长。未来可能会有更多的开发者入场,分享其创新的设计和实现方法,并希望形成更大的社区。在技术的发展面前,更新迭代也会给自制硬件钱包带来更多机遇。
然而与此相对,安全隐患将是支撑长期发展的巨大挑战。开发者需要保持高度敏感性,持续关注安全技术的发展,更新自身硬件钱包的安全策略与实践。此外,自制钱包的合规性与合法性问题也将在其未来发展中受到监管的密切关注。
总的来说,自制加密硬件钱包是一个充满潜力的领域,期待越来越多的用户勇于尝试,并构建一个更加安全的数字资产存储环境。